About AXA SA
AXA, based in Paris, is one of the world's largest insurers, offering property and casualty cover, life and health insurance and asset management across Europe, Asia and beyond. Years of reshaping the portfolio toward less volatile insurance lines have made its earnings steadier and its balance sheet stronger. AXA is a classic income holding, paying a high, dependable dividend and following a clear policy of distributing a healthy share of profits, supplemented by share buybacks. A generous, reliable yield backed by strong capital gives it one of the higher DiviScores in the index.
